Why Frozen Precooked Beans Are a Time-Saving Hero for Foodservice Operators

If you’ve ever cooked dry beans at scale, you know the drill: soaking for hours, monitoring boil times, adjusting seasoning, and dealing with inconsistent textures. This becomes even more challenging in high-volume commercial kitchens. Frozen precooked beans eliminate all that.

Key advantages for restaurants and meal prep kitchens:

  • Zero soaking or boiling required

  • Uniform texture that’s perfect every time

  • Reduced labor and energy costs

  • Longer shelf life compared to chilled beans

  • Less waste, especially in operations with fluctuating demand

Creative Ways to Incorporate Frozen Precooked Beans Into Menu Items

If you’re looking for new ideas to incorporate beans, here are creative applications that work in both restaurants and meal prep programs.

1. Add Them to Global Bowls and Entrées

Beans shine in cuisine from around the world.

  • Latin: black beans for burrito bowls

  • Mediterranean: chickpeas for shawarma bowls

  • American Southwest: pinto beans for loaded nachos

  • Indian: kidney beans for rajma curry

  • Caribbean: pigeon peas for rice dishes

4. Use Beans to Reduce Food Costs

Beans can act as natural protein extenders for:

  • Chili

  • Meat sauces

  • Stuffings

  • Stews

They help control costs without sacrificing taste.
